FIFA Referees Seminar Takes Place in Doha
Doha, February 10 (QNA) - Chairman of the Referees Committee of the Qatar Football Association and Vice Chairman of the FIFA Referees Committee Hani Taleb Ballan inaugurated this evening the FIFA Seminar for Elite Women Referees, with the participation of women referees from the Asian, African, and Oceanian confederations. The seminar is being hosted in Doha from Feb. 9 to 13, 2026.
The opening ceremony was attended virtually by Italian Chairman of the FIFA Referees Committee Pierluigi Collina, along with FIFA refereeing officials. A total of 16 women referees are taking part in the seminar, including seven from Asia, eight from Africa, and one from Oceania.
In his opening remarks, Ballan welcomed the participants to the FIFA seminar, expressing his pleasure at Doha hosting this important refereeing event. He affirmed that the selected group of elite women referees reflects FIFA’s commitment to developing women’s refereeing and raising its technical and physical standards.
Ballan said that the seminar's program includes specialized theoretical lectures, discussion sessions, as well as precise medical and physical tests, in addition to practical on-field applications involving players, ensuring maximum technical benefit for the participating referees.
He added that there will be eight friendly matches held, during which the referees’ performances will be comprehensively evaluated, contributing to their preparation for upcoming international assignments.
The Chairman of the Qatar Football Association Referees Committee noted that the seminar represented an important milestone in the preparation of elite women referees and comes as part of FIFA’s strategy to qualify women refereeing cadres according to the highest international standards.
For his part, Collina praised the extensive facilities provided by the Qatar Football Association, stressing that the organizational and technical capabilities available in Doha greatly contribute to the success of such specialized seminars.
Collina also wished all participating referees success, expressing his anticipation of positive outcomes that would be reflected in the level of women’s refereeing in upcoming international competitions.
It is worth noting that this seminar is one of three FIFA seminars hosted by Qatar during the month of February. The FIFA seminar for Video Assistant Referee (VAR) officials from the Asian and African football confederations was previously held from Feb. 3 to 5, 2026.
